>How do I send the FOCUS back to a field from a VALID?
RETURN .F. or RETURN 0 or RETURN [tabordernextfield of interest]
It's easy to get trapped in WHEN/VALID now so I try to only got/set/lostfocus and use the lostfocus event for validation and repositioning. Usually any gotfocus() code is ok to prime the field for the user (i.e. reset to empty/null/default this.value stuff)
HTH
Gary
Helping Make Ideas Reality